Item 1. Security and Issuer.
Item 1 of the Schedule 13D is hereby amended and restated in its entirety
as follows:
This Amendment No. 4 amends the Schedule 13D filed with the Securities and
Exchange Commission (the "SEC") on June 23, 2003, as amended by Amendment No. 1
filed with the SEC on January 26, 2004, Amendment No. 2 filed with the SEC on
September 9, 2004 and Amendment No. 3 filed with the SEC on September 22, 2004
(the "Schedule 13D") by Sigma-Tau Finanziaria S.p.A., an Italian corporation
("Sigma Tau") and Defiante Farmaceutica, L.d.a., a Portuguese corporation
("Defiante", and together with Sigma Tau, the "Reporting Parties") with respect
to the Common Stock, $0.01 par value (the "Common Stock"), of RegeneRx
Biopharmaceuticals, Inc. (the "Issuer"), a Delaware corporation whose principal
offices are located at 3 Bethesda Metro Center, Suite 700, Bethesda, Maryland
20814.
Item 2. Identity and Background.
Item 2 of the Schedule 13D is hereby amended and restated in its entirety
as follows:
This Schedule 13D is being filed jointly on behalf of Sigma Tau, and
Defiante. Sigma Tau owns 58% of Defiante directly and 42% indirectly through its
wholly-owned subsidiary, Sigma-Tau International S.A.
The business address of Sigma Tau is Via Sudafrica, 20, Rome, Italy 00144.
The principal business of Sigma Tau is as a parent holding company whose
principal assets consists of the common stock of its subsidiaries which form a
fully integrated pharmaceutical company operating in Europe, the United States
and Africa.
The business address of Defiante is Rua dos Ferreiros, 260 Funchal,
Madeira, Portugal 9000-082. Defiante is a commercial pharmaceutical company.

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.
Item 3 of the Schedule 13D is hereby amended and restated in its entirety
as follows:
On March 7, 2002, pursuant to a Securities Purchase Agreement, dated as of
March 7, 2002, between the Issuer and Defiante, Defiante purchased 4,255,319
shares of Common Stock at a cash purchase price of $0.235 per share as part of a
private placement. Defiante used its working capital to purchase such shares.
On June 11, 2003, pursuant to a Securities Purchase Agreement, dated as of
June 11, 2003, between the Issuer and Defiante, Defiante purchased 3,184,713
shares of Common Stock at
Page 4 of 12
$0.628 per share. Defiante used its working capital to purchase such shares. In
consideration for the purchase of such shares, on June 11, 2003, the Issuer
issued to Defiante a warrant ("Warrant A") to purchase 750,000 shares of Common
Stock exercisable at a price of $1.00, in whole or in part, at any time and from
time-to-time from issuance of such warrant through December 11, 2004 and (ii) a
warrant ("Warrant B" and, collectively with Warrant A, the "2003 Warrants") to
purchase up to a number of shares of Common Stock determined by dividing
$750,000 by the Warrant B Exercise Price (as defined below) during the Warrant B
Period (as defined below). The Warrant B Period was defined as the period
commencing on the earlier of (a) the date the Issuer closed the next round of
private financing (after June 11, 2003) totaling at least $2,000,000 (the "Next
Private Placement") or (b) December 11, 2003, and ending on December 11, 2004.
The initial Warrant B Exercise Price was equal to the greater of (a) $1.25 or
(b) the price per common share (either directly or after giving effect to any
conversion into common shares) at which the Company closed the Next Private
Placement. As a result of the 2004 Common Stock Transaction (as defined below),
the Warrant B Exercise Price became fixed at $1.25 on January 23, 2004. The
Warrant B was then exercisable for 600,000 shares of Common Stock.
The terms of Warrant A and Warrant B were amended on September 2, 2004
pursuant to a Warrant Amendment Agreement dated as of September 2, 2004 to
provide that, if the holder exercised the 2003 Warrants, by not later than
September 6, 2004, the 2003 Warrants would be exercisable for a total of
1,382,488 shares of Common Stock at an exercise price of $1.085 per share.
Defiante exercised the 2003 Warrants on September 3, 2004 at an exercise
price of $1.085 per share and received 1,382,488 shares of Common Stock.
On January 23, 2004, pursuant to a Securities Purchase Agreement, dated as
of January 23, 2004, between Issuer and Defiante, Defiante purchased 1,052,632
shares of Common Stock at $0.95 per share (the "2004 Common Stock Transaction").
Defiante used its working capital to purchase such shares. In consideration for
the purchase of such shares, on January 23, 2004, the Issuer issued to Defiante
a warrant (the "2004 Warrant") to purchase 263,158 shares of Common Stock
exercisable at a price of $1.50, in whole or in part, at any time and from
time-to-time from issuance of such warrant through July 23, 2006.
On January 7, 2005, pursuant to a Purchase Agreement, dated as of January
7, 2005 between Issuer and Sigma Tau, Sigma Tau purchased 984,615 shares of
Common Stock at $3.25 per share as part of a private placement. Sigma Tau used
its working capital to purchase such shares. In consideration for the purchase
of such shares, on January 7, 2005, the Issuer issued to Sigma Tau warrants (the
"2005 Warrants") to purchase 246,154 shares of Common Stock exercisable at a
price of $4.06 per share, in whole or in part, at any time and from time-to-time
from issuance of such Warrant through January 3, 2008.

(c) If, but only if, at any time after one year from the date of issuance
of this Warrant there is no effective Registration Statement registering the
resale of the Warrant Shares by the Holder, this Warrant may also be exercised
at such time by means of a "cashless exercise" in which the Holder shall be
entitled to receive a certificate for the number of Warrant Shares equal to the
quotient obtained by dividing [(A-B) (X)] by (A), where:
2
(A) = the average closing price for the five trading days immediately prior
to (but not including) the date of such election;
(B) = the Exercise Price of the Warrants, as adjusted; and
(X) = the number of Warrant Shares issuable upon exercise of the Warrants
in accordance with the terms of this Warrant.
(d) No fractional shares of Common Stock are to be issued upon the exercise
of this Warrant, but rather the number of shares of Common Stock issued shall be
rounded up or down to the nearest whole number.

Section 7. Adjustment of Exercise Price and Number of Shares. The Exercise
Price and the number of Warrant Shares shall be adjusted from time to time as
follows:
(a) Stock Splits. If the Company subdivides (by any stock split,
recapitalization or otherwise) its outstanding shares of Common Stock into a
greater number of shares, the Exercise Price in effect immediately prior to the
subdivision will be proportionately reduced and the number of Warrant Shares
will be proportionately increased. If the Company combines (by combination,
reverse stock split or otherwise) its outstanding shares of Common Stock into a
smaller number of shares, the Exercise Price in effect immediately prior to the
combination will be proportionately increased and the number of Warrant Shares
will be proportionately decreased. Any adjustment under this Section shall
become effective at the close of business on the date the subdivision or
combination becomes effective.
(b) Stock Dividends. If the Company declares a dividend or any other
distribution upon the Common Stock that is payable in shares of Common Stock or
securities convertible into shares of Common Stock, the Exercise Price in effect
immediately prior to the declaration of the dividend or distribution will be
reduced to the quotient obtained by dividing (i) the number of shares of Common
Stock outstanding immediately prior to the declaration multiplied by the then
effective Exercise Price by (ii) the total number of shares of Common Stock
outstanding immediately after the declaration.
